25 Ryker blasted through the Tridents, eradicating the enemy force. The Legion fighters vaporized into dust clouds of debris and gas. Another wave entered the system. Turning her Interceptor, she switched to her remaining missiles. In eight seconds, she had a lock on the leading Trident. Moving like a robot, she pulled the trigger and continued to the next bandit. Tridents exploded, unable to react to her swift and lethal execution. Hours passed, the kills racking up on her HUD. The skill of the simulated Legion Star Runners increased, but it didn’t matter. She battled through the enemy waves like a vengeful spirit, untouchable as she weaved through the responding fire. When the last Trident exploded, her HUD went dark.
